Annua IEDM 67 a Decembri 11-15, 2021 in Hilton San Francisco Unionis Quadrati deversorium tenebitur.

Argumentum huius anni est "machina nova electronicorum: Ab 2D Materiis ad 3D Architecturas", ad cogitandum duas trends potentissimas industriae: usus materiae sic dictae 2D (densitates habentium in atomis mensuratas) ut transistores amplius minuat. ; et usus variarum 3D architecturarum plura incorporandi notas et effectus a fabrica ad fasciculum ad sarcinam incorporandi.

Vespertina Panel Sessio - Martis vespera, die 14 Dec

Stapulae IEEE IEDM colloquium est sessionis decuriae vespertinae, forum interactivum ubi periti de rebus maximis industriae sentiant, et audientium participatio fovetur ad fovendam apertam ac vehementem notionum commutationem. Titulus tabulae vespertinae huius anni est "Estne Hardware/Software Co-Designare malum necessarium vel consortium symbioticum?" Moderatus a Myung-hee Na, Semiconductor Technologist et VP of Revolutionary Technology Centre in SK hynix, explorabit ideam illius quid hardware/software co-consilium realiter significat in terminis evolutionis technologiae et novae technologiae introductio.
